a:link    			{ color: #aeb548;    font-family: helvetica, arial, sans-serif; font-size: 12px; line-height: 150%; font-style: normal; text-decoration: none}
a:visited 			{ color: #aeb548;    font-family: helvetica, arial, sans-serif; font-size: 12px; line-height: 150%; font-style: normal; text-decoration: none}
a:hover, pseudolink_grn:hover  
					{ color: #bbb;		font-family: helvetica, arial, sans-serif; font-size: 12px; line-height: 150%; font-style: normal; text-decoration: none}
			
#grund				{position:relative; margin:64px auto;      width:781px; height:555px; z-index:0;  visibility:visible; }
#schatten_oben		{position:absolute; top:31px;  left:0px;   width:780px; height:5px;   z-index:3;  visibility:visible; }
#schatten_links		{position:absolute; top:36px;  left:0px;   width:5px;   height:495px; z-index:5;  visibility:visible; }
#schatten_rechts	{position:absolute; top:36px;  left:770px; width:10px;  height:495px; z-index:6;  visibility:visible; }
#schatten_unten		{position:absolute; top:531px; left:0px;   width:780px; height:8px;   z-index:7;  visibility:visible; }
#menu0				{position:absolute; top:0px;   left:290px; width:400px; height:19px;  z-index:2;  visibility:visible; }
#inhalt				{position:absolute; top:36px;  left:5px;   width:765px; height:495px; z-index:10; visibility:visible; }
#minimenu			{position:absolute; top:541px; left:10px;  width:750px; height:16px;  z-index:9;  visibility:visible; }

#slogan_d        	{position:absolute; top:380px; left:27px;  width:420px; height:116px; z-index:21; visibility:visible; cursor:pointer; }

#zoombtn		 	{position:absolute; top:461px; left:371px; width: 10px; height: 10px; z-index:30; visibility: hidden; }

#zoomgrund		 	{position:absolute; top:  0px; left:  0px; width:765px; height:495px; z-index:40; visibility: hidden; text-align: center; background: url(../qo_pic/qo_zoom_hg.png) repeat; }

.haendchen			{ cursor:pointer; }

.pseudolink_grn		{ color: #aeb548; font-family: helvetica, arial, sans-serif; font-size: 12px;                    font-style: normal; text-decoration: none; cursor:pointer; }
.lauftext_schwarz 	{ color:    #000; font-family: helvetica, arial, sans-serif; font-size: 12px; line-height: 150%; font-style: normal; text-decoration: none; height: 490px; overflow: auto;}
.lauftext_schw_win 	{ color:    #000; font-family: helvetica, arial, sans-serif; font-size: 12px; line-height: 130%; }
.mini_menu, a.mini_menu:link, a.mini_menu:visited	
					{ color: #445426; font-family: helvetica, arial, sans-serif; font-size: 10px; }
/* lauftext_schwarz einheitlich an p angepasst mit 12 Pkt und lineheight geändert*/